City of Kodiak 710 Mill Bay …Kodiak is proud to offer a full range of dockage, boat yard and marine services for commercial fishing, cargo, passenger, and recreational vessels. The facilities are owned by the City of Kodiak; operated, and maintained by the City's Harbor Department. Two harbors provide protected moorage for 650 vessels up to 150 feet in length. Special Meeting . …Kodiak, with a population hovering around 6,000, is the largest city on Kodiak Island. Kodiak Island is the largest island in Alaska and the second largest island in the U.S., after Hawaii’s Big Island. Kodiak is only accessible via air or boat. The purpose of the Water Utility is to insure that the collection, treatment, storage, transmission and distribution of water is done in a professional manner which …The City of Kodiak is home to about 6,100 residents, with approximately 13,500 people living in several communities in the Kodiak Island Borough. The economy of Kodiak is based on commercial fishing and seafood processing. The City Council is comprised of six members who are elected at large for three-year terms. The Council, by ordinance, enacts legislation, sets policy, adopts the budget, and regulates the fiscal affairs of the City. Kodiak, Alaska 99615 Phone: 907.486.8650 Fax: 907.486.8600.At 3,588 square miles, Kodiak Island is the second largest island in the United States, second only to the island of Hawaii. The city of Kodiak is 250 air miles southwest of Anchorage and is the seventh largest city in the state. A very helpful …The City of Kodiak (Alutiiq: Sun'aq) is the main city and one of seven communities on Kodiak Island in Kodiak Island Borough, Alaska. All commercial transportation between the island's communities and the outside world goes through this city via ferryboat or airline. As of the 2020 census, the population of the city is 5,581, down from 6,130 in 2010. It is the …Kodiak Island Borough, Alaska.
